Anningella

Bivalvia - Pectinida - Buchiidae

Taxonomy
Anningella was named by Cox (1958) [Sepkoski's age data: Tr Rhae J Sine-u Sepkoski's reference number: 93,94].

It was assigned to Pterioida by Sepkoski (2002); and to Buchiidae by Vokes (1980) and Ros-Franch et al. (2014).

Synonyms
  • Anningia was named by Cox (1936). It is not extant.

    It was replaced with Anningella by Cox (1958).
